What are the best literary magazines to submit short stories?
Well, 'Tin House' is a top choice. It has a reputation for featuring innovative and engaging short stories. 'Ploughshares' is also very good. It has been around for a long time and has a history of publishing great short works. Then there's 'ZYZZYVA', which is a bit more on the indie side but is highly regarded among the literary community for its unique approach to short story publishing.

What are some magazines to submit literary fiction?
Well, there are several magazines suitable for submitting literary fiction. Ploughshares is quite well - known in the literary community. It offers a platform for various forms of literary works including fiction. McSweeney's also accepts submissions of literary fiction. They are open to unique and creative voices. Then there's Zoetrope: All - Story. It has a reputation for publishing engaging literary fiction pieces.

What are some literary magazines to submit short stories?
The New Yorker is a great option. It has a wide readership and a reputation for publishing high - quality short stories. Another one is Glimmer Train. They focus specifically on short fiction. And then there's Tin House, which is known for its eclectic mix of literary works.

What are the best magazines to submit short stories?
There are several magazines that are great for submitting short stories. For example, Zoetrope: All - Story. It is associated with the famous filmmaker Francis Ford Coppola and has a reputation for publishing engaging short stories. Another excellent magazine is One Story. As the name implies, they publish one story at a time, and it can be a great place for new writers to get their work noticed. Then there is Electric Literature, which is known for its contemporary and diverse short story offerings.

Best Fantasy Magazines to Submit Short Stories
Some great fantasy magazines to submit short stories to are 'Fantasy & Science Fiction'. It has a long history of publishing high - quality speculative fiction. Another one is 'Clarkesworld', which is known for its diverse range of science fiction and fantasy stories. 'Lightspeed' is also a good choice as it features various sub - genres within the fantasy realm.

How can one submit flash fiction to literary magazines?
First, you need to carefully read the submission guidelines of the literary magazine. Each magazine has its own specific requirements. For example, some may require a certain format for the manuscript, like double - spaced text. Then, prepare your best flash fiction piece. Make sure it is polished and adheres to the magazine's word limit. After that, you can usually submit it through their online submission system or by email if they specify so.
